HFSP vs. MKTN
HFSP (TradersAI Large Cap Equity & Cash ETF) and MKTN (Federated Hermes MDT Market Neutral ETF) are both exchange-traded funds - HFSP is a Long-Short fund actively managed by Tidal, while MKTN is a Equity Market Neutral fund actively managed by Federated. Both are actively managed. Their 0.03 correlation means their historical movements had little consistent relationship. HFSP charges 1.25%/yr vs 1.94%/yr for MKTN.
